  • Opened but not decanted about two hours before service, then air in the glass for about 20 minutes. I think this is a typical representation of Niagara Pinot Noir from a vintage that was decent, but somewhat challenging.

    Light in body, with a light red color throughout. Upon opening the palate showed the typical raspberries, but after a couple of hours plus time in the glass the wine took on more weight. A typical Pinot spiciness emerged that made the wine even more attractive. I would not hold this wine any longer, but do give it a bit of air to show its stuff.

  • Popped and poured. Medium red with a touch of bricking on the rim. Palate of raspberries with very noticeable acidity and moderate tannins. A very nice wine that was good with salmon but would work with lighter meats as well. The wine might benefit from a little more bottle age, but no reason to hold off.
